Ball Valve Technologies: Addressing the Needs of a Hydrogen Future

The rapidly developing hydrogen economy presents novel challenges for infrastructure development. As demand for clean energy increases, ball valves are playing a critical role in ensuring the safe and efficient distribution of hydrogen gas.

These versatile components offer several benefits uniquely suited to hydrogen applications. Ball valves are known for their robustness, able to withstand the demanding conditions often associated with hydrogen handling. Their leak-proof design minimizes the risk of leaks, a {critical{concern when dealing with this highly flammable gas.

Furthermore, ball valves are adaptable, allowing for on/off control and accurate flow regulation. This makes them ideal for a spectrum of applications in the hydrogen economy, including fuel cell vehicles, power generation, and industrial processes.

Continuously research and development are pushing the boundaries of ball valve technology. Improvements such as new materials, coatings, and drive mechanisms are enhancing the performance and reliability of ball valves for hydrogen service.
